That is correct, warfarin is a blood thinning drug, which means that it makes the blood less likely to clot. It is also sold under the name coumadin. People who are at risk of a heart attack or stroke may need to take this drug.

What are the drug interactions associated with bromelain?

Not to be combined with other blood-thinning medications, such as warfarin, heparin or aspirin or other blood-thinning herbs such as garlic or gingko biloba.


Can ruta interact with warfarin?

Ruta has been reported to cause negative interactions with sodium warfarin, a blood-thinning medication.


What are the drug interactions associated with taking horse chestnut?

Not to be taken by those with bleeding disorders or taking anticoagulant drugs. Increases the blood thinning activity of warfarin or aspirin.
